Time Zone Details

Ceuta is a Spanish autonomous city located on the north coast of Africa, sharing a border with Morocco. Situated on the Strait of Gibraltar, it is a unique European exclave known for its strategic port, military history, and a distinct blend of Spanish and North African cultures. Its geography is marked by its coastal position and the Monte Hacho hill.

Does Ceuta observe Daylight Saving Time?

Yes. Ceuta observes Daylight Saving Time, known as Central European Summer Time (CEST). It typically begins on the last Sunday in March when clocks are set forward one hour to CEST (UTC+2). It ends on the last Sunday in October when clocks are set back one hour to CET (UTC+1).
